Words from Programme Coordinator
Contrary to common belief, creators do not live in dreams. Those who do are blind and deaf to the outside world. Quite the opposite, creators do not take the world around them at face value; they probe and they query beliefs that are taken for granted. They want to dig up new possibilities. Careful observation leads to constructive questionings, dialogues and discussions, which in turn inspires ideas for creations and their realizations.

The learning process takes place in the real world. There are limitations to adjust to and difficulties to overcome. Mistakes are unavoidable and they are in fact part of the process of self-consolidation and self-exploration. Only through the full grappling of reality can we know ourselves and be true to ourselves.

Olive Leung
Programme Coordinator (Foundation Diploma in Visual Art)
